#105Taipei Chapter, Taiwan One day trip and January Monthly Meeting (Flower Design Performance)
The sun was warm and pleasant. The breeze was light and gentle. It was a nice day for our outing on October 16, 2023. We visited an old camphor plant from 1937 in Miaoli County and learned to make essential oil soap by ourselves. The lunch meal with a local special product, the red dates, was delicious. Then we went to the Rixin Island on Mingde Reservoir to observe and find the five kinds of native trees in Taiwan: Acacia confusa, Chinaberry, silk tree, Sapindus mukorossi and Terminalia catappa. After finding them, we enjoyed a cup of aromatic coffee. The final stop of our outing was a tomato farm in Xinzhu County. They grow various tomatoes. And we all liked shopping, too. We got lots of things in our hands on our way home. It was a happy and abundant trip.
We had a flower design performance at the monthly meeting on January 15th, 2024 at National Taiwan University Hospital Convention Center Room 101. It was performed by Mr. Shang-Yang, Wu. The theme was called “western style and eastern appearance”. He said he intended to use the ideas of western design to show you the thoughts of eastern flower arrangement. He totally did twelve works with different materials and containers. Our board members also did their flower arrangements for display to appeal to people.
